Transaction 95e311aa548b0284d36eb680b7a19dcf34349fb9d4d1e9172005dfed318e32e3

1 Input
2 Outputs
  • 95e311aa548b0284d36eb680b7a19dcf34349fb9d4d1e9172005dfed318e32e3:0
  • value  300000000
    address  15FurCKsofcRZkY9Kpcu9vn3BrPezZ36wK
  • 95e311aa548b0284d36eb680b7a19dcf34349fb9d4d1e9172005dfed318e32e3:1
  • value  27047558
    address  3EdM6k5ufF9yXaV6CW2btGKrnPgNT2KQjg